본문 바로가기

세상살이

(304)
[C/C++] 구조체배열(Structure Array)의 바이너리 파일 입출력 구조체배열(Structure Array)의 바이너리 파일 입출력 //파일 ---> 구조체 void readFileTheater(theater* th) { FILE* fp; fp = fopen("THEATER_FILE", "rb"); for(int i=0;i 파일 void writeFileTheater(theater* th) { FILE* fp; fp = fopen("THEATER_FILE", "wb"); for(int i=0;i
[OpenCV] 두 이미지의 차영상 만들기 # 이미지의 차(뺄셈) 이용 이미지(x,y) - 이미지(x,y) = 결과이미지(x,y) @ OpenCV를 이용한 활용 //차영상 만들기 for(int _height = 0 ;_height height ; _height++) { for(int _width = 0; _width width ; _width++) { int differ_value; differ_value = gray_image1->imageData[_height * gray_image1->width + _width] - gray_image2->imageData[_height * gray_image2->width + _width]; differ_value = abs(differ_value); if..
[OpenCV] cvCreateImage 함수 IplImage *img = cvCreateImage( size, depth, chennal ); cvCreateImage는 IplImage 구조체의 메모리를 생성하여 그 포인터를 넘겨 준다. - 첫번째 size는 이미지의 크기이다. ( 가로와 세로의 길이를 입력) CvSize 구조체를 이용하여 설정 cvCreateImage( cvSize( 가로 길이, 세로 길이 ) ... ); 또는 cvGetsize 함수를 이용하여 IplImage 이미지의 크기를 얻어와서 설정할 수 있다. CvSize size = cvGetSize( img ); cvCreateImage( cvGetSize(img), .... ); - 두번째 입력 값은 depth 이다. ( 한 이미지를 표현하는 비트의 크기) 일반적으로 한 픽셀은 0~..
[C/C++] 삼항 연산자 삼항연산자는 if ~ else 보다 간결히 표현할 때 사용하는 연산자 이다. 삼항연산자의 사용법은 다음과 같다, 조건 ? A : B 조건이 true인 경우 A를, False인 경우 B를 반환한다.
[English] 빈도부사 위치 (1) 빈도부사+일반동사 (2) be, 조동사+빈도부사 always, never, often, sometimes, usually가 대표적(불규칙적) 빈도부사. 그러나 이런 불규칙적 빈도부사 이외에도, hardly, rarely, scarcely, seldom같이 ‘좀처럼[거의] ~ 않다’라는 뜻의 준부정어도 빈도부사이며, every, weekly, monthly, quarterly(분기마다), bi-annually(일년에 두 번), annually(일 년마다) 등 정확하고 규칙적인 빈도를 나타내는 부사도 빈도부사에 속한다고 알아두면 좋습니다. 그런데 이 녀석들이 각각 위치하는 곳이 각각 다르다는 게 문제죠. 준부정어와 규칙적 빈도부사의 위치는 다음과 같이 잡아주면 됩니다. 1. 준부정어 : 일반동사 앞,..
[OpenCV] Visual Studio .Net에서 설정 방법 Visual Studio .Net에서 설정 방법 1. 메뉴에서 Tools >> Options >> Projects >> VC++ Directories 에서 다음과 같은 디렉토리를 추가 - Include files 항목에서 추가 할 디렉토리 C:\PROGRAM FILES\OPENCV\CXCORE\INCLUDE C:\PROGRAM FILES\OPENCV\CV\INCLUDE C:\PROGRAM FILES\OPENCV\OTHERLIBS\HIGHGUI C:\PROGRAM FILES\OPENCV\OTHERLIBS\CVCAM\INCLUDE - Library files 항목에서 추가 할 디렉토리 C:\PROGRAM FILES\OPENCV\LIB 2. 메뉴에서 Project >> Properties >> Linker >..
[TIP] 윈도우 7 에서 빠른 실행 도구 만들기 1. 작업표시줄 우클릭 - 작업 표시줄 잠금 해제 2. 작업표시줄 우클릭 - 도구모음 - 새 도구 모음 3. 폴더라고 되어있는 빈칸에 다음을 복사해서 붙여 넣습니다. %userprofile%\AppData\Roaming\Microsoft\Internet Explorer\Quick Launch 4. Quick Launch에서 우클릭 - 텍스트표시/제목표시 해제, 보기 - 큰 아이콘 5. Quick Launch를 작업표시줄 왼쪽으로 마우스로 끌어 옮긴다. 6. 작업표시줄 우클릭 - 작업 표시줄 잠금 설정
[TIP] 윈도우 숨겨진 기능 GodMode 설정 방법 ‘GodMode’는 윈도우에서 사용자가 콘트롤 할 수 있는 대부분의 옵션 설정을 한 곳에서 할 수 있도록 하는 기능을 말한다 바탕화면에서 새폴더 만든후 새폴더 이름을 GodMode.{ED7BA470-8E54-465E-825C-99712043E01C} 로 수정하면 GodMode 실행이 가능한 아이콘이 생긴다. ‘GodMode’는 윈도우 설정을 유저가 쉽게 변경할 수 있는 편리한 기능이지만 64비트 비스타 운영체제에서 사용하면 부팅이 안될 수 있으므로 주의해야 한다.

반응형